相关疑难解决方法(0)

获取当前VBA功能的名称

对于错误处理代码,我想获取发生错误的当前VBA函数(或子)的名称.有谁知道如何做到这一点?

[编辑]谢谢大家,我曾希望存在一个无证的技巧来自我确定功能,但这显然不存在.猜猜我会继续使用我当前的代码:

Option Compare Database: Option Explicit: Const cMODULE$ = "basMisc"

Public Function gfMisc_SomeFunction$(target$)
On Error GoTo err_handler: Const cPROC$ = "gfMisc_SomeFunction"
    ...
exit_handler:
    ....
    Exit Function
err_handler:
    Call gfLog_Error(cMODULE, cPROC, err, err.Description)
    Resume exit_handler
End Function
Run Code Online (Sandbox Code Playgroud)

ms-access vba

30
推荐指数
5
解决办法
4万
查看次数

标签 统计

ms-access ×1

vba ×1